GN Espace unveils energy saving OceanChef XL electric induction cooker for large yachts

by GNEspace 1 Nov 2021 06:34 PDT
Super-sleek fit of GN Espace's OceanChef XL on the brand new Oyster 595 © GN Espace

Specialist galley manufacturer GN Espace will be revealing its brand new OceanChef XL electric induction cooker at METSTRADE in Amsterdam on 16-18 November 2021.

Built in marine grade stainless steel to the highest standards of craftsmanship and incorporating the latest energy saving technology the new extra-large professional marine cooker is designed with large-sized luxury cruising and charter yachts, typically 60-90ft, in mind.

Manufactured in the UK, the OceanChef XL packs some cutting-edge features into its sleek look, for safe, stylish, convenient and fun meal preparation for guests and crew. The perfect solution for boat owners and charter operators looking to go fully electric on board, the OceanChef XL combines in a single cavity the benefits of induction cooking on the hob with the practical features of a multifunction oven and powerful grill.

At 62cm wide the OceanChef XL features a versatile four-zone induction hob. Zones can also be combined into larger areas by bridging them into one or two oval cooking zones. Sturdy removeable sea-rail hob surround and adjustable pan clamps ensure safe cooking at sea.

The roomy and fast-heating Gastronorm-based oven is a professional sized 53 litre capacity that can accommodate a range of Gastronorm dishes and trays like the professional standard full size stainless steel GN1/1 dishes, available from GN Espace. With a maximum heat setting of 250°C the OceanChef oven is also perfect for baking. It is fully insulated and has a powerful fan heating element providing even heat distribution through the interior. The grill is flush fitting giving extra height and a design that allows you to cook on three levels at once. The cookware is held safely in place by the oven frame which also has a safety stop to avoid hot food accidentally sliding out of the oven when the door is opened. A unique ECO Fan setting reaches the most widely used oven temperature (180 degreesC) in less than half the time it takes for a traditional electric oven to reach its higher equivalent temperature, saving time and valuable electricity.

The OceanChef XL's energy management system is designed for optimum performance while conserving consumption to a limit of 8.5kW, 25% less than an equivalent domestic four-zone induction hob and electric oven which, until now, has typically been installed on larger sailing yachts.

The OceanChef XL is set to become the choice of builders of new sailing and motor yachts but it can also be retrofitted by owners wanting to replace an older cooker. The dimensions are the same as GN Espace's ubiquitous LPG version of the OceanChef cooker and will fit into the housing of this and similar cooker models.

The OceanChef XL is now available direct from manufacturer GN-Espace who can also provide a full range of kitchen accessories to create a beautiful and practical interior galley space. The first OceanChef XL models are already being fitted as standard to a range of luxury blue water sailing yachts currently in build to be ready for autumn 2021 delivery.
